WILLINGNESS TO PAY FOR WATER QUALITY IMPROVEMENTS: THE CASE OF PRECISION APPLICATION TECHNOLOGY AgEcon
Hite, Diane; Hudson, Darren; Intarapapong, Walaiporn.
A contingent valuation survey conducted in Mississippi is used to assess public willingness to pay for reductions in agricultural nonpoint pollution. The analysis focuses on implementation of a policy to provide farmers with precision application equipment to reduce nutrient runoff. Findings suggest public support exists for such policies. This study also finds that inclusion of debriefing questions can be used to refine willingness-to-pay estimates in contingent valuation studies. A nonparametric scope test suggests respondents are sensitive to level of runoff reduction and associated water-quality benefits.

A Watershed-Based Economic Model of Alternative Management Practices in Southern Agricultural Systems AgEcon
Paudel, Krishna P.; Hite, Diane; Intarapapong, Walaiporn; Susanto, Dwi.
We investigated the environmental impacts of alternative cultural practices within a watershed under different water quality standards. We used experimental data on nutrient runoff to determine the optimal amount of broiler litter application in hay production in Louisiana. To compensate for the lack of experimental data, we used biophysical simulation models to find the optimal combination of agricultural best-management practices in a watershed in Mississippi. The results indicated that stricter environmental standards lower total profit potential and litter utilization.

Use of On-Farm Reservoirs in Rice Production: Results from the MARORA Model AgEcon
Popp, Jennie S. Hughes; Wailes, Eric J.; Young, Kenneth B.; Smartt, Jim; Intarapapong, Walaiporn.
The present article uses the modified Arkansas off-stream reservoir analysis and the environmental policy-integrated climate models to examine the impacts of on-farm reservoirs and tail water recovery systems in conjunction with other best management practices on profitability, water use, and sediment control for rice-soybean farming operations. Results suggest that, under limited water availability conditions, reservoirs and tail water recovery systems can improve profitability, reduce ground water dependence, and reduce the movement of sediment, nutrients, and pesticides off-farm. Although reservoirs may not be profitable under plentiful water conditions, cost-sharing opportunities may make them a viable means of addressing environmental concerns.
